The MSc Computer Science course at the University of East London is designed to offer a progressive, challenging and stimulating framework of study, which is not only relevant to the needs of future computing professionals, but also culturally sensitive and engaging. The course stands as one that combines both practical programming and computational theory in order to give its students a well-rounded and dynamic education in the field of computer science. It is a course that can be completed full-time in one year or part-time in two years.Course Content: The academic content of this course is geared towards training students in advanced concepts and technologies, including computer programming, system analysis and design and software tools, among other aspects. A coursework-driven course, it focuses on the latest technological advances and the principles underlying them. The program climaxes with students utilizing everything that they've learnt in a final project which can either be research or industry related.Key Modules: Some of the key modules within this course include: Advanced Software Engineering, Information Security, Machine Learning and Computational Intelligence, Business Analysis and Process Modelling, Software Quality Assurance and Testing, and Advanced Big Data Analytics. Future Careers: After completing this course successfully, you have vast scope for employment in a wide spectrum of industries. The opportunities range from software development and health informatics to business systems analysis and design, and from data analysis and legal computing to research, teaching and further studies. For more information on this course, please visit the official course page.